New Richter boys will play six dates for launch of Gangs
Alt-rock instrumentalists And So I Watch You From Afar set out in May on an Irish tour to promote their new album Gangs. The raucous foursome will bring their incendiary fuse-lit energy to Limerick (Dolan's Warehouse) on May 18, Castlebar (Ritz) on May 19, Mullingar (The Stable) a night later on May 20 and finally The Forum, Waterford on May 21. As previously reported here, the boys also play Album Launch shows at the Button Factory, Dublin (April 29) and Mandela Hall, Belfast (April 30).
Gangs is released on the Richter Collective label on May 2 and is surely one of the most eagerly-awaited Irish releases of the year.
